Jimmy Fallon's Donald Trump calls 'Barack Obama' to celebrate Indiana win
Donald Trump didn't just win Tuesday's presidential primary in Indiana; since Ted Cruz and John Kasich dropped out immediately afterwards, he also cinched the Republican nomination. So on Wednesday's episode of The Tonight Show, Jimmy Fallon envisioned how Trump might have reacted to his victory.
The answer is, apparently, call President Barack Obama (Dion Flynn). Fallon's Trump bragged about how he was now "the Republican president" and "come November, I'm going to be voted Captain America." But even though Trump now has the nomination all but secured, his presumptive opponent, Hillary Clinton, is still fighting off Bernie Sanders, a fact that both amused and confused the skit's participants.
"What is it with that guy? You can't get rid of him. He's like glitter," Flynn's Obama said. "You think he's gone, and then four days later you're like, 'What the hell are you still doing there?'"
RELATED: Celebrity Endorsements 2016: See Stars' Political Affiliations
Fallon's Trump went for a Jon Snow comparison, leading Flynn's Obama to complain about spoilers (unrealistic, since we all know now that Obama gets advance screeners of Game of Thrones). After Fallon's Trump complained about the size of Westeros' Wall (not big enough for him), Flynn's Obama tried to give Fallon's Trump some advice. Fallon-Trump, naturally, responded by making a birther joke.
"Don't make me go Lemonade on your ass," Flynn-Obama said. "Cause I will."
"Watch it, you don't want to mess with Donald with the good hair," Fallon-Trump said.
